I have had a cold and it has left me with a dry cough. I have been awake with it for the last 3 nights. All the syrups and cough sweets in the supermarket / pharmacy contain some form of sugar so are off limits. Does anyone have any suggestions to help me stop coughing long enough to get some sleep.
Thanks in advance

I find golden milk helps. There are several recipes online, but this is nearest to my method. I use almond or coconut milk, but think it is ok whatever milk you choise. I don’t use a sweetner, through choice, but if cough is really bothersome I will use a half teaspoon of honey.
https://www.healthline.com/nutrition/golden-milk-turmeric#section11


I also use steam inhalation before trying to sleep. Just run hot shower without ventilation. Then menthol crystals in hot water, or if too tired just use Vick vapour rub on tissue on pillows. Prop up with extra pillow and try to relax.

Yes, I use these myself, and have found them excellent.

However, each time I buy them, I scrutinise the pack, and sometimes ask the pharmacist if they are suitable.
Sometimes these manufacturers change the formulations without us knowing.
 
Thanks for the suggestions.
I asked at the local pharmacy and their recommendation was Pholcodine sugar free.
I am armed with that for tonight and hopefully that and paracetamol and sudafed and sugar free sweets should see me through the night.
